jdk17引发错误 /lib64/libc.so.6:版本`glibc_2.6'未找到

发布于 2025-01-30 04:21:11 字数 450 浏览 6 评论 0原文

我正在将项目从1.8升级到JDK 17。在Ubuntu 18上一切正常。

在尝试使用JDK17编译项目时,我会收到以下错误:

Error: dl failure on line 542
Error: failed /****/apps/java/jdk-17.0.3.1/lib/server/libjvm.so, because 
/lib64/libc.so.6: version `GLIBC_2.6' not found (required by /****/apps/java/jdk-17.0.3.1/lib/server/libjvm.so)

OS版本:CENTOS版本:CENTOS版本5.11(final) 打开JDK版本:JDK-17.0.2 Oracle JDK版本:JDK-17.0.3.1

在不升级OS版本的情况下解决此问题的任何方法,因为我们无法升级OS一段时间。

I am in process of upgrading my project from 1.8 to jdk 17. Everything works well on Ubuntu 18.

While attempting to compile the project with JDK17, I get following error:

Error: dl failure on line 542
Error: failed /****/apps/java/jdk-17.0.3.1/lib/server/libjvm.so, because 
/lib64/libc.so.6: version `GLIBC_2.6' not found (required by /****/apps/java/jdk-17.0.3.1/lib/server/libjvm.so)

OS version: CentOS release 5.11 (Final)
Open JDK version: jdk-17.0.2
Oracle JDK version: jdk-17.0.3.1

Any ways to get around this issue without upgrading the OS version as we cannot upgrade OS for a while.

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。
列表为空,暂无数据
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文